An accelerated bachelor completion program that combines core business management with healthcare-specific coursework and a research capstone. Suited to working adults and current healthcare employees who want managerial skills applicable to clinics, corporate medical settings or health systems leadership.

What you'll study

The major builds foundational business knowledge (management, organizational behavior, marketing, accounting) and advances into healthcare-focused topics. Students complete upper-division business courses plus healthcare emphasis courses and a research capstone. Students must earn at least a C- in business administration-healthcare administration courses to receive credit.

  • Co-requisite courses (6 units): ECON 103 Introduction to Economics; MATH 205 Introductory Statistics.
  • Required courses (27 units): ACCT 301 Accounting for Management; BUS 430 Business Information Systems; BUS 431 Organization Behavior; BUS 434 Individual in the Organization; BUS 442 Ethics and Values in Organizations; BUS 475 Law and the Business Environment; FIN 460 Business Finance; INTB 370 International Business; MKT 320 World of Marketing.
  • Healthcare emphasis (9 units): HC 320 Healthcare Politics and Ethics; HC 435 Quality Management in Healthcare; HC 450 Health Care Systems Administration and Information Technology.
  • Capstone (3 units): HC 480 Health Care Research Design.
  • Electives: select additional business courses from any emphasis area to reach required total credits.

Entry requirements

Applicants submit an online application and provide official transcripts from previously attended colleges, universities and high schools (sent electronically to trans.evaluator@fresno.edu). A GED transcript or an AA/AS/AS-T/AA-T from an accredited college will serve as proof of high school completion. Military applicants should submit military transcripts and DD214 forms. The program is offered as evening accelerated or online accelerated delivery.

Career prospects

Coursework prepares graduates to plan, manage and improve operations and services in healthcare settings — from private physician offices to corporate medical environments and health systems. Emphases such as quality management, healthcare law and IT plus the research capstone aim to equip students for roles in administration, operations, compliance, quality improvement and leadership/management within healthcare organizations.
